Corroboration of ADHD symptoms

Adults with attention-deficit/h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) exhibit symptoms of restlessness and emotional dysregulation. These symptoms can result in impaired social functioning, poor decision-making, and low self Assessment adhd test-esteem. It has been discovered that treatment can alleviate these symptoms. A number of validated assessment scales have been designed to aid in the identification of adults suffering from ADHD.

The Wender-Reimherr Adult Attention Deficit Disorder Scale, the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ale, the FAST Minds, and the Conners Adult ADHD Rating Scales can be used to identify people suffering from ADHD. There are many treatment options

Adult ADHD treatments can enhance the quality of life of patients. Treatments include medication, lifestyle modifications and the use of behavioural therapy. There are numerous other options. These include the use of nutritional supplements, antidepressants and a nonstimulant.

Insomnia is the most common treatment-related issue. It is vital to take note of and utilize medication to manage sleep disturbances. Adult ADHD patients may benefit from sedation or hypnotic medication to improve their sleep quality.

Another complication of adult ADHD is anxiety. ADHD patients are more likely than others to feel stressed and anxious, and tend to dwell on past failures. Counseling might be needed. Counseling can help patients learn strategies to manage their anger, as well as other reactions and how to manage failures.

A major issue is the adherence to medication. Around 20% of adults forget to refill their medication. Doctors can suggest ways to increase compliance. Patients can use reminder apps on their phones to remind them or have their family members call them.

Each patient is unique, therefore each treatment is tailored to their individual needs. Some patients respond well to stimulants and others require nonstimulants. Stimulants are typically the first choice to treat ADHD. Nonstimulants are sometimes prescribed in the event that the patient is unable to respond to stimulants or if they have an associated psychiatric condition.
